Mine cost around 7K USD (currency being what it is, 7K is expensive for someone living in china, but still affordable overall. And much cheaper than if I get it in say the UK where I was looking at 10-15k sans insurance. Cheapest in China is around 3K USD I think , and is done at a state-funded hospital. But they need YOUR PARENTS SIGNATURE which is crazy work for me a thirty year old.

Here are some details about recovery for anyone interested / researching peri esp if you live in china.

1) I actually wanted DI, but my doctor strongly suggested peri, and I ultimately went with her suggestion.

2) I started working the day after I had surgery. I have an editing job. Would not recommend I think it really fucked me up, not physically or with the wounds etc, just overall. But hey. No way around that.

3) China doesn’t have very accessible transgender care. So this is done as part of a “cosmetic surgery”/plastic surgery, not a medical one. That means paying everything out of pocket but I personally think the price is not exorbitant.

4) I really should have taken recovery more seriously overall. I went in honestly just thinking I need to be back at work asap. Made no special preparations whatever. That being said, i have no trouble taking care of myself throughout the process. It’s just…. So much more Draining (pun not intended) than I imagined.
